What Yin Is
Yin Yoga is a slow, mostly seated or floor-based practice where each posture is held quietly for three to five minutes. Where Vinyasa works the muscles, Yin works the deeper layers — the fascia, ligaments, and joints. It is the perfect counterbalance to busy, active lifestyles.
What a Yin Class Feels Like
- Length: 75 minutes
- Pace: Very slow. Long holds.
- Postures: Mostly floor-based shapes — Butterfly, Dragon, Sphinx, Saddle, Square. Supported with bolsters and blankets.
- Effort: Minimal physical effort. You will be still for most of the class.
- Best for: Tight hips, lower back issues, stress, anyone over 50, athletes who need to balance their training
Who Benefits Most
- Desk workers — tight hips, neck, shoulders from sitting
- Runners, cyclists, weight lifters — chronically tight hamstrings, IT bands, and hip flexors
- People over 50 — maintains joint mobility and counters age-related tightness
- Anyone with chronic stress — Yin activates the parasympathetic nervous system. You leave feeling deeply calm.
Is It Boring?
The first few times, holding a posture for five minutes can feel weird. By class three or four, most students start to crave it. The stillness becomes addictive.
